Spesifikasi GW INSTEK GSP-9300 SPECTRUM ANALYZERS
Frequency Frequency Range 9 kHz to 3.0 GHz Resolution 1 Hz Frequency Reference Accuracy ±[(period since last adjustment X aging rate) + stability over temperature + supply voltage stability Aging Rate ±2 ppm max. 1 year after last adjustment Frequency Stability over Temperature ±0.025 ppm 0 to 50 °C Supply Voltage Stability ±0.02 ppm Frequency Readout Accuracy Start, Stop, Center, Marker ±(marker frequency indication X frequency reference accuracy + 10% x RBW + frequency resolution*1) Sweep points 601 Span >= 100 Hz 6 to 601 Span = 0 Hz Marker Frequency Counter Resolution 1 Hz, 10 Hz, 100 Hz, 1 kHz Accuracy ±(marker frequency indication X frequency reference accuracy + counter resolution)
Amplitude Amplitude Range Measurement Range 100 kHz to 1 MHz Displayed Average Noise Level (DANL) to 18 dBm 1 MHz to 10 MHz DANL to 21 dBm 10 MHz to 3 GHz DANL to 30 dBm Attenuator Input Attenuator Range 0 to 50 dB, in 1 dB step Auto or manual setup Maximum Safe Input Level Average Total Power <= 33 dBm Input attenuator
≥10 dB DC Voltage ± 50 V 1 dB Gain Compression Total Power at 1st Mixer > 0 dBm Typical;Fc ≥50 MHz; preamp. off Total Power at the Preamp > -22 dBm mixer power level (dBm)= input power (dBm)-attenuation (dB) Displayed Average Noise Level (DANL)*4 Preamp off 0 dB attenuation; RF Input is terminated with a 50 Ohm load. RBW 10 Hz; VBW 10 Hz; span 500 Hz; reference level = -60dBm; trace average ≥ 40 9 kHz to 100 kHz, < -93 dBm Nominal 100 kHz to 1 MHz, < -90 dBm - 3 x (f/100 kHz) dB 1 MHz to 10 MHz, < -122 dBm 10 MHz to 3 GHz, < -122 dBm Preamp on 0 dB attenuation; RF Input is terminated with a 50 Ohm load. RBW 10 Hz; VBW 10Hz; span 500 Hz; reference level = -60dBm; trace average ≥ 40 100 kHz to 1 MHz, < -108 dBm - 3 x (f/100 kHz) dB Nominal 1 MHz to 10 MHz, < -142 dBm 10 MHz to 3 GHz, < -142 dBm + 3 x (f/1 GHz) dB [4] DANL spec shall exclude the Spurious Response
Level Display Range Scales Log, Linear Units dBm, dBmV, dBuV, V, W Marker Level Readout 0.01 dB Log scale 0.01 % of reference level Linear scale Level Display Modes Trace, Topographic, Spectrogram Single / split Windows Number of Traces 4 Detector Positive-peak, negative-peak, sample, normal, RMS(not Video) Can be setup for each trace separately Trace Functions Clear & Write, Max/Min Hold, View, Blank, Average Absolute Amplitude Accuracy Absolute Point Center=160 MHz ; RBW 10 kHz; VBW 1 kHz; span 100 kHz; log scale; 1 dB/div; peak detector; 20 to 30°C; signal 0 dBm Preamp off ± 0.3 dB Ref level 0 dBm; 10 dB RF attenuation Preamp on ± 0.4 dB Ref level -30 dBm; 0 dB RF attenuation Frequency Response Preamp off Attenuation: 10 dB; Reference: 160 MHz; 20 to 30°C 100 kHz to 2.0 GHz ± 0.5 dB 2.0GHz to 3.0 GHz ± 0.7 dB Preamp on Attenuation: 0 dB; Reference: 160 MHz; 20 to 30°C 1 MHz to 2.0 GHz ± 0.6 dB 2.0GHz to 3.0 GHz ± 0.8 dB Attenuation Switching Uncertainty Attenuator setting 0 to 50 dB in 1 dB step Uncertainty ± 0.25 dB reference: 160 MHz, 10dB attenuation RBW Filter Switching Uncertainty 1 Hz to 1 MHz ± 0.25 dB reference : 10 kHz RBW Level Measurement Uncertainty Overall Amplitude Accuracy ± 1.5 dB 20 to 30°C; frequency > 1 MHz; Signal input 0 to -50 dBm; Reference level 0 to -50 dBm;
Input attenuation 10 dB;
RBW 1 kHz; VBW 1 kHz; after cal; Preamp Off ± 0.5 dB Typical Spurious Response Second Harmonic Intercept Preamp off; signal input -30dBm; 0 dB attenuation +35 dBm Typical; 10 MHz < fc < 775 MHz +60 dBm Typical; 775 MHz ≤ fc < 1.5 GHz Third-order Intercept Preamp off; signal input -30dBm; 0 dB attenuation > 1dBm 300 MHz to 3 GHz Input Related Spurious < -60 dBc Input signal level -30 dBm, Att. mode, Att=0 dB; 20-30 degree C Residual Response (inherent) <-90 dBm Input terminated; 0 dB attenuation; Preamp off Sweep Sweep Time Range 22ms to 1000s Span >= 100 Hz 50us to 1000s Span = 0 Hz; Min Resolution = 10 us Sweep Mode Continuous; Single Trigger Source Free run; Video; External Trigger Slope Positive or negative edge RF Preamplifier Frequency Range 1 MHz to 3 GHz Gain 18 dB Nominal
(installed as standard) Front Panel Input/Output RF Input Connector Type N-type female Impedance 50 ohm, nominal VSWR <1.6 :1 300 kHz to 3 GHz; Input attenuator ≥ 10 dB Power for Option Connector Type SMB male Voltage/Current DC +7V / 500 mA max With short-circuit protection USB Host Connector Type A plug Protocol Version 2.0 Supports Full/High/Low speed MicroSD Socket Protocol SD 1.1 Supported Cards MicroSD, MicroSDHC Up to 32GB capacity Rear Panel Input/Output Reference Output Connector Type BNC female Output Frequency 10 MHz Output Amplitude 3.3V CMOS Output Impedance 50 ohm Reference Input Connector Type BNC female Input Reference Frequency 10 MHz Input Amplitude -5 dBm to +10 dBm Frequency Lock Range Within ± 5 ppm of the input reference frequency Alarm Output Connector Type BNC female; Open-collector Trigger Input/ Gated Sweep Input Connector Type BNC female Input Amplitude 3.3V CMOS Switch Auto selection by function LAN TCP/IP Interface Connector Type RJ-45 Base 10Base-T; 100Base-Tx; Auto-MDIX USB Device Connector Type B plug For remote control only; supports USB TMC Protocol Version 2.0 Supports Full/High speed IF Output Connector Type SMA female Impedance 50 ohm Nominal IF Frequency 886 MHz Nominal Output level -25 dBm 10 dB attenuation; RF input: 0 dBm @ 1 GHz; Earphone Output Connector Type DVI-I ( integrated analog and digital) , Single Link Compatible with VGA or HDMI standard through adapter RS232 Interface Connector Type D-sub 9-pin female Tx,Rx,RTS,CTS GPIB Interface (Optional) Connector Type IEEE-488 bus connector AC Power Input Power Source AC 100 V to 240 V, 50 / 60 Hz Auto range selection Battery Pack (Optional) Battery pack 6 cells, Li-Ion rechargeable, 3S2P With UN38.3 Certification Voltage DC 10.8 V Capacity 5200 mAh / 56Wh General Internal Data storage 16 MB nominal Power Consumption <65 W Warm-up Time < 30 minutes Temperature Range +5 °C to +45 °C Operating -20 °C to + 70 °C Storage Weight 4.5 kg (9.9 lb) Inc. all options (Basic+TG+GPIB+Battery) Dimensions 210 x 350 x 100 (mm) Approximately 8.3 x 13.8 x 3.9 (in) Tracking Generator*5 (Optional) Frequency Range 100 kHz to 3 GHz Output Power -50 dBm to 0 dBm in 0.5 dB steps Absolute Accuracy ± 0.5 dB @160 MHz, -10 dBm, Source attenuation 10 dB, 20 to 30°C Output Flatness Referenced to 160 MHz, -10 dBm 100 kHz to 2 GHz ± 1.5 dB 2 GHz to 3 GHz ± 2.0 dB Output Level Switching Uncertainty ± 0.8 dB Referenced to -10 dBm Harmonics < -30 dBc Typical, output level = -10 dBm Reverse Power +30 dBm max. Connector type N-type female Impedance 50 ohm Nominal Output VSWR < 1.6:1 300 kHz to 3 GHz, source attenuation ≥ 12 dB [5] The minimum RBW filter is 10 kHz when the TG output is ON.
USB Power Sensor (Optional) Type Average power sensor Model: PWS-06 Interface to Meter USB cable to GSP930 Front-Panel USB Host Connector Type N-type male, 50 ohm nominal Input VSWR 1.1: 1 Typical 1.3: 1 Max Input Frequency 1 to 6200 MHz Sensing Level -32 to +20 dBm Max. Input Damage Power <= 27 dBm Power Measurement Uncertainty
@ 25 °C -30 dBm to +5 dBm: 1 MHz to 3GHz: ±0.10 dB typical ±0.30 dB max. 3 GHz to 6 GHz: ±0.15 dB typical ±0.30 dB max. +5 dBm to +12 dBm: 1 MHz to 3GHz: ±0.15 dB typical ±0.30 dB max. 3 GHz to 6 GHz: ±0.15 dB typical ±0.30 dB max. +12 dBm to +20 dBm: 1 MHz to 3GHz: ±0.20 dB typical ±0.40 dB max. 3 GHz to 6 GHz: ±0.20 dB typical ±0.40 dB max. Power Measurement Uncertainty
@ 0 to 25 °C -30 dBm to +5 dBm: 1 MHz to 3GHz: ±0.25 dB typical 3 GHz to 6 GHz: ±0.25 dB typical +5 dBm to +12 dBm: 1 MHz to 3GHz: ±0.20 dB typical 3 GHz to 6 GHz: ±0.20 dB typical +12 dBm to +20 dBm: 1 MHz to 3GHz: ±0.35 dB typical 3 GHz to 6 GHz: ±0.30 dB typical Linearity @ 25 °C ±3 % Measurement Speed 100 ms for Low Noise Mode Typical 30 ms for Fast Mode
